Who lives here?

Bendale, Toronto is an east Toronto neighbourhood notable for its science professionals, salespeople and tradesp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from China, the Philippines, India and Sri Lanka, and Cantonese, Tagalog, Mandarin and Tamil speakers.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of youth aged 20 to 24 and adults aged 25 to 29.
